1. Conversion Rate
The conversion rate is a key performance sign that suggests exactly how well your advertising initiatives are functioning. A high conversion price indicates that your product or service is relevant to your audience and is likely to prompt a substantial number of people to take the desired action (such as making a purchase or signing up for an email newsletter).
A low conversion rate indicates that your marketing technique isn't effective and needs to be reworked. This could be due to a lack of compelling content, ineffective call-to-actions, or a complex internet site format.
It is necessary to remember that a 'conversion' does not need to indicate a sale. It can be any kind of preferred activity, such as a newsletter signup, downloaded book, or form submission. Agencies often pair the Conversion Price with various other KPIs like Click-Through Price, Consumer Life Time Value, and Victory Rate to offer clients an extra thorough sight of project efficiency. This enables them to make smarter and much more data-backed decisions.

3. Customer Commitment
Keeping consumers faithful and happy returns several advantages. Faithful customers have a tendency to have a higher consumer lifetime worth, and they're typically more receptive to brand interactions, such as a request for responses or an invitation to a brand-new product launch. Dedicated clients can also reduce marketing expenses by referring new service to your company, aiding it to flourish also in competitive markets.
As an example, picture your shopping clothing and essentials team makes use of journey analytics to uncover that numerous consumers who surf but do deny frequently desert their carts. The group then teams up with the data scientific research team to produce personalized e-mail advocate these cart abandoners that include suggestions, discounts, and item recommendations based upon what they have actually already watched and purchased. This drives conversions and commitment, inevitably increasing sales and earnings.
4. Revenue
Profits is the total amount of cash your business makes from sales and various other transactions. Profits is also an essential efficiency indicator that's utilized to review your advertising method and determine your next actions.
The data-driven insights you acquire from consumer journey analytics equip your group to deliver customized communications that meet or exceed clients' assumptions. This results in even more conversions and much less churn.
To gather the best-possible understanding, it is necessary to use a real-time client information platform that can merge and organize information from your internet, mobile apps, CRM systems, point-of-sale (POS), and a lot more. This permits you to see your consumers in their full trip context-- as an example, when a prospect first shows up on your internet site via retargeted ads, after that involves with live chat, register for a cost-free trial, and then upgrades to a paid product. By making the data-derived understandings obtainable to all stakeholders, you can make better decisions in a timely way.
